Unfortunately, Miracast mirroring, as used on Windows 10 and newer, as well as some Android devices, is currently only available in AirServer Connect devices, AirServer Universal, and AirServer for Windows Desktop Edition.
Windows and Android Operating Systems, are using Intel's Wi-Fi Direct technology for peer to peer discovery and connections while the Mac uses Apple's Wireless Direct Link for peer to peer discovery and connections.
Currently, Mac computers from Apple do not have the hardware or drivers required to use Wi-Fi Direct. If the hardware and drivers installed on Apple's Mac computers support the Wi-Fi Direct Technology, we will go ahead and add the Miracast feature to AirServer for Mac.
A workaround for this limitation is to use Google Chrome to mirror from Windows to Mac.
